Survivor 50 episode 9 is titled “I Deserve All of This” will see the castaways spend the next day picking up the pieces of their alliance after two were voted off last week as they face off against a surprise challenger during this week’s individual immunity competition, according to Rotten Tomatoes.
The “Survivor 50” cast features returning players from the show’s first 49 seasons and celebrities will be making appearances “in unique ways” throughout the season, according to CBS.

Day 18 – once again individual immunity is back up for grabs
Everyone has to hold onto their PRE-GAME body weight, last one standing gets immunity.
Five players have to give up their chance at immunity for enough rice for the rest of the season with a side bet- they have to outlast Jeff Probst.
Jeff Probst historic side bet
If the host outlasts one person, he keeps the rice.
Jonathan, Joe, Ozzy and Tiff volunteer, Probst wants to play so he accepts four.
Probst said the side bet is not a setup.
Probst said this was Jimmy Fallon’s idea. 90% of Jimmy’s audience wanted the host to participate as a player.

Recap the of previous episode
Last week was Double the Fun, Double the Demise as Benjamin “Coach” Wade from Seasons 18 (Tocantins – The Brazilian Highlands), 20 (Heroes vs. Villains), 23 (South Pacific), and Chrissy Hofbeck from Season 35 (Heroes vs. Healers vs. Hustlers) were the 12th and 13th people voted off of Survivor 50.
The tribe divided into pairs. The twist was that even though the remaining players would vote individually, each single person would be voting for one of the duos that teamed up.
The pairs were Coach and Chrissy, Ozzy and Stephenie, Christian and Jonathna, Joe and Tiff, Rizo and Emily, and Devens and Aubry.
Joe and Tiff won and bonded over spaghetti, wine and immunity.

Rick plays his false idol
In the second episode of Survivor 50, Christian told Rick Devens from Season 38 (Edge of Extinction) about his boomerang. Rick conspired to plant a false idol during the next tribal council and was legitimately giddy over the idea of blowing up the game with this idea.
Last week Rick got his wish -he played nervous during tribal, though he was legit nervous as his partner and himself were obviously on the hot seat. Then he said he didn’t have an idol to play just a clue to an idol then pulled out his plant.
Dee was smiling on the sideline “oh my god this is amazing” as the cliques scrambled.
Coach quoted Magellan for this iconic tribal council.
“It’s not real but it was real enough to cause a ruckus,” Rick said.
